Stax IT Manager, Derek Doyle, recently completed a gruelling 3-day coast-to-coast and back again cycle ride raising £7,000 in aid of The Lullaby Trust.
A cause very close to Derek’s heart, The Lullaby Trust supported Derek’s family through a very difficult time, when his brother’s baby daughter was taken too soon due to SIDS (Sudden Infant Death Syndrome).
The team of four completed the 276 miles of cycling from 27th to 29th August, which included 19,130 feet of hill climbing and the burning of almost 9000 calories.
